Oil falls as higher OPEC+ output expectations weigh on sentiment
May 27 (Reuters) - Oil prices slipped for a second session on Tuesday on increasing expectations members of the Organisation of Petroleum Exporting Countries and their allies, known as OPEC+, will decide to increase their output at a meeting later this week.

Harmony Gold agrees to buy Australian miner Mac Copper for $1 billion
JOHANNESBURG, May 27 (Reuters) - Harmony Gold HARJ.J, South Africa's largest gold producer by volume, agreed to buy Australian miner Mac Copper Ltd MTAL.N in a deal worth $1.03 billion.
